Qatar uses social media websites heavily to spread hate speech and slander Saudi Arabia. Doha has hundreds of employees on social media sites, particularly twitter, pretending to be Saudi citizens and attacking the Saudi ruling family, security reports showed.
The mercenaries posting with these accounts seek to frustrate Saudis by defending Qatar, overstating Doha’s power, and marketing Iran to the Arab Middle East, Saudi newspaper Okaz reported.
There are nearly 6000 users tweeting at a rate of 90 tweets per minute, according to a report by Nayef Academy for National Security in 2015.
Known as "electronic committees" in Arab countries, they became popular during the unfolding of the Arab "Spring". They are basically a group of people paid to target a specific object based on strict guidelines, creating an artificial but desired viewpoint on social media websites.
